After a modest start on a few sitcoms in the late 80s, Shore got his big break in 1989 as an Creator/{{MTV}} VJ. By 1992, he was their most popular host, regularly hosting the channel's spring break specials and even his own show, ''Totally Pauly'', and had made the leap to feature films with the CultClassic ''Film/EncinoMan''. From then until 1995, he'd star in three more star vehicles, one released per year and all of which had him playing variations of his "Weasel" character: ''Film/SonInLaw'', ''In The Army Now'' and ''Jury Duty''. He'd also voice an animated variation on the character in ''WesternAnimation/AGoofyMovie'', serving as one of the film's many beloved [[UnintentionalPeriodPiece mid-'90s artifacts]].
